Interview process first starts with a recruiter, recruiter booked me in to an online interview and gave some preparation notes. There were 2 SQL based questions and 3 Python based questions. Roughly 45 minutes to complete all 5. I made it up to 4 and ran out of time.
Feedback was given shortly after a week. Although I didn't make it through the interviewer was good and the recruiter even gave me a debrief call to discuss.

I gave the first coding round at Atlassian for Data Engineer role. As this role at Atlassian requires a lot of SQL and Python skills, the coding round had 3 questions for SQL (one was leading after another) and 1 Python based programming question.
Questions were pretty straight forward if you would have prepared well for it.

SQL questions:
1. First question was based on the ranking and join to get the solution
2. Second follow up question used the same database and tables. The question asked for a rolling average based on last 3 days.
3. Third question was again based on a rolling sum and then count query based on that rolling sum.
All of the SQLs required CTE statements
Lastly the Python programming question was a basic for loop to search the position of a target number. Interviewer asked for a different approach of solving it.
Consists of three programming rounds plus two culture fit.
None of the leetcode questions are there under Atlassian. Maybe try hackerrank or learn without route learning it.
First technical interview was done to assess if they wanted you to continue. Each subsequent required in depth knowledge of either python and algorithms but also system design for senior engineers.
